| The sigrok project aims at creating a portable, cross-platform, Free/Libre/Open-Source signal analysis software suite that supports various device types (e.g. logic analyzers, oscilloscopes, and many more). It is licensed under the terms of the GNU GPL, version 3 or later. Design goals and features include: Broad hardware support. Supports many different devices (logic analyzers, oscilloscopes, multimeters, data loggers etc.) from various vendors.Cross-platform. Works on Linux, Mac OS X, Windows, FreeBSD, OpenBSD, NetBSD, Android (and on x86, ARM, Sparc, PowerPC, ..).Scriptable protocol decoding. Extendable with stackable protocol decoders written in Python 3.File format support. Supports various input/output file formats (binary, ASCII, hex, CSV, gnuplot, VCD, WAV, ..).Reusable libraries. Consists of the libsigrok and libsigrokdecode shared libraries which can be used by various frontends/GUIs.Various frontends. PulseView (LA/DSO/MSO GUI), SmuView (DMM/PSU/load GUI) and sigrok-meter (DMM GUI), sigrok-cli (command-line), and other frontends all build upon the above libraries.
You can use sigrok to..  ..log data from your multimeter ..have a $10 logic analyzer for examining logic circuits ..have a remote GUI for your oscilloscope ..perform measurements on signals ..make sense of digital signals with protocol decoders
 ..write custom protocol decoders in python ..remote-control your power supply ..remote-control whatever lab device you'd like to support ..write a quick-n-dirty automation tool for your particular needs ..have a framework/frontend for your home-made devices

AquaTerm is a Mac OS X grahics renderer. It allows command line applications written in ObjC, C, FORTRAN, Lisp, Perl or Python to display vector graphics, text and images using a simple API. Adapters for gnuplot, PGPLOT, and PLplot exists as well. I just bought a macbook pro recently. The first thing that I need is to setup the latex environment to write.
